About this trial

The current study is to evaluate the comparative effects of low-level laser therapy and muscle energy technique on pain, range of motion, and functional results in diabetic patients with frozen shoulder. This research aims to enhance the existing data on managing diabetes-related musculoskeletal issues by assessing the comparative advantages of various therapies, therefore assisting physicians in choosing appropriate, patient-centred rehabilitation procedures.

Eligibility criteria

Qualifiers

Eligible participants were male and female individuals aged 18 to 65 years with a verified diagnosis of type 2 diabetes mellitus and clinical manifestations of frozen shoulder for at least three months. The diagnosis was determined by limited glenohumeral joint mobility, characterised by a decrease of ≥20° in a minimum of three active movements: flexion <144°, abduction <120°, and external rotation <72°. Cases of both unilateral and bilateral nature were incorporated.

Disqualifiers

The exclusion criteria included a history of traumatic shoulder injury or prior surgery; neurological involvement, such as brachial plexus injury or cervical radiculopathy; rotator cuff tears or other ligamentous pathologies; tumours or malignancies affecting the shoulder; and corticosteroid injection within the preceding three months
